One of the most exciting developments in the world of parking systems is the emergence of automated and smart parking solutions. These systems use sensors, cameras, and other technological tools to streamline the process of finding and accessing parking spaces. By utilizing real-time data and intelligent algorithms, these systems can efficiently guide drivers to available spots, reducing the time and effort spent searching for a space. Some smart parking systems even offer smartphone apps that allow drivers to reserve parking spots in advance, eliminating the need for circling the block in search of a spot.

Another key trend in the evolution of car parking systems is the move towards sustainable and eco-friendly solutions. With growing concerns about climate change and air pollution, many cities are implementing green parking initiatives to reduce the environmental impact of parking facilities. This includes the installation of electric vehicle charging stations, bike racks, and greenery in parking lots to promote alternative modes of transportation and reduce emissions. Some cities are even exploring the possibility of integrating solar panels into parking structures to generate renewable energy and offset carbon emissions.

Furthermore, the integration of smart technology and data analytics is revolutionizing the way parking facilities are managed and optimized. By collecting and analyzing data on parking patterns, occupancy rates, and user behavior, parking operators can make informed decisions to improve efficiency and customer experience. For example, predictive analytics can be used to anticipate peak parking demand and adjust pricing or capacity accordingly. By leveraging data-driven insights, parking operators can maximize revenue, minimize idle time, and enhance overall operational efficiency.

One of the biggest challenges facing urban mobility today is the scarcity of parking spaces in congested city centers. This has led to increased competition for limited parking spots, resulting in higher prices and longer wait times. To address this issue, innovative parking solutions such as automated parking garages and robotic valet services are being implemented to optimize space utilization and maximize efficiency. These automated systems use mechanical lifts and robotic platforms to stack cars vertically or horizontally, significantly reducing the footprint of traditional parking structures. By making more efficient use of available space, these solutions can help alleviate parking shortages and congestion in busy urban areas.
